Is MDMA legal in Sri Lanka?

Confirmed against a primary sourceVerified June 26, 2026
Legal status
Controlled under the Dangerous Drugs Ordinance — illegal; not confirmed in the Sec 54A capital schedule in the primary source — confirm classification
Consequences if caught
MDMA is controlled under the Poisons, Opium and Dangerous Drugs Ordinance, but it is NOT confirmed in the Sec 54A capital schedule in the reachable primary source — confirm its classification before relying on it. Sri Lanka retains the DEATH penalty for this offence (Sec 54A): death OR life imprisonment for manufacturing or for trafficking/possessing/importing/exporting above the Third Schedule thresholds. CRITICAL NUANCE: the death penalty is NON-MANDATORY (courts treat it as discretionary) AND Sri Lanka is under a long-standing EXECUTION MORATORIUM — sentences are passed and people held on death row, but no executions have been carried out for decades.

Sri Lanka retains the death penalty for serious drug offences (Sec 54A), but it is NON-MANDATORY (treated as discretionary) and the country is under a long-standing EXECUTION MORATORIUM — death sentences are passed and people held on death row, but no executions have been carried out for decades. Cannabis is NOT a capital offence. Possession of under 1 g where the person agrees to rehabilitation can be diverted to treatment (2007 Act).
